发明名称 Method and device for allocating common channel resources
摘要 A resource allocation method and device are provided that can achieve uniform loads on and stable quality of a common channel available to mobile stations having no dedicated channels. A method for allocating common channel resources in a system in which a plurality of first radio communication devices transmit data to a second radio communication device over a common channel, based on first resource allocation information, includes: by the second radio communication device, transmitting second resource allocation information to at least one of the first radio communication devices; and by each of the first radio communication devices, transmitting data to the second radio communication device over the common channel, based on any one of the first resource allocation information and the second resource allocation information.

主权项 1. A method for resource allocation in a system comprising a plurality of first radio communication devices capable of performing data transmission to a second radio communication device, the method comprising: transmitting resource allocation information from the second radio communication device to one first radio communication device of the plurality of first radio communication devices, wherein the resource allocation information comprises dedicated resource allocation information; if the one first radio communication device receives an acknowledgement from the second radio communication device in response to the one first radio communication device sending a preamble signature, the one first radio communication device performing a first data transmission using a default transmission profile; if the one first radio communication device receives a negative acknowledgement from the second radio communication device in response to the one first radio communication device sending the preamble signature, and the one first radio communication device does not receive the dedicated resource allocation information with the negative acknowledgement, the one first radio communication device performing a preamble signature retransmission to the second radio communication device; and if the one first radio communication device receives the negative acknowledgement from the second radio communication device and the one first radio communication device receives the dedicated resource allocation information with the negative acknowledgement, the one first radio communication device performing a second data transmission using the dedicated resource allocation information, the second data transmission being different from the preamble signature retransmission.
